National Employee Benefits Day 2024: Which Benefits Foster Belonging?

Extensis

National Employee Benefits Day , created in 2004 by the International Foundation of Employee Benefit Plans (IFEBP), aims to highlight the importance of employee benefits. 94% offer a retirement savings plan to their employees, and 84% provide a matching contribution.

5 Ways SMBs Can Celebrate National Employee Benefits Day

Extensis

National Employee Benefits Day , created in 2004 by the International Foundation of Employee Benefit Plans, aims to highlight the importance of employee benefits. At the same time, offering the right plans to employees is one of the most impactful ways to attract and retain talent.
